Kids needed to talk about life

Kids in a playground

Children from all over the UK are being asked what's important to them and what they think makes a good childhood.

A charity called the Children's Society is behind the massive study to find out what issues you're facing and what changes could make things better.

Newsround's also helping out, so over the next few months we'll be asking you different questions about what matters to you and what you do and don't like.

Your answers will help adults find ways to improve children's lives.

The study is called the Good Childhood Inquiry and is taking place for most of the year. The results will be published in 2008.
